Rapalo offers new single-family homes starting for less than $250k in Venice

Since opening this spring, sales have been strong in Rapalo, a gated community by Express Homes of Southwest Florida offering four home plans, all starting at less than $250,000. Located less than two miles from the beautiful sandy beach of Manasota Key, Rapalo offers unusual values on new single-family homes in the desirable Venice area.
 
Only 109 homes are planned to be built in this neighborhood-style community, with many homesites offering beautiful lake views. Construction on a resort-style pool and adjoining pavilions is expected to begin later this year.
 
The four one-story home plans range from 1,542 to 1,848 square feet of living space, offering three or four bedrooms, two baths and a two-car garage. The public is invited to tour the professionally decorated 1,756-square-foot Eastham model. A covered entry and foyer flows into an expansive great room and adjoining dining room, and this welcoming space opens onto the lanai. A separate kitchen features an extended breakfast nook with large windows overlooking the front lawn for cozy family meals.
 
Situated between Sarasota and Fort Myers, Rapalo is close to Venice Island, the historic downtown area offering dining, shopping and entertainment right on the Gulf of Mexico waterfront.
